Express Scripts Canada administers on behalf of Indigenous Services Canada Claim Adjudication.  This role entails adjudicating Non-Insured Health Benefit Dental Claims for Indigenous people in Canada.

The role of a Claims Processor is to register, review, validate, and adjudicate claims on a daily basis ensuring data integrity in the system.  Claims Processors are responsible for processing Pay Provider, Pay Client and Client Reimbursement claims for all regions and are responsible for ensuring all pended claims are processed within the standard turn-around time.

This role is instrumental in meeting our Claims Processing Service Levels which contributes to customer satisfaction and minimizes risk of financial penalties.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Register, review, validate, and adjudicate claims on a daily basis as per processes documented in the APM.

  • Monitor and handle pended claims to ensure they are settled according to the Service Level Standards.

  • Prepare and send a Dental Provider Missing Information Return Form based on the requestor’s communication preference (mail or fax) and language preference for claims with missing or illegible data.

  • Consistently meet the minimum accuracy standards of 98%.

  • Consistently meet the productivity standards for assigned quotas within the established Service Delivery Standards.

  • Participate in frequent quality and productivity touchpoints.

  • Engage in bi-weekly claim department and monthly benefit process meetings.

  • Handle claim adjustments that are provided from various departments.

  • Participate in annual Privacy and Compliance Training.

About Express Scripts Canada

Express Scripts Canada is a leading health benefits manager and has been recognized as one of the most innovative. Our clients include Canada's leading insurers, third party administrators and governments. We work with these clients to develop industry-leading solutions to deliver superior healthcare in a cost-controlled environment. We provide Active Pharmacy™ services to more than 7 million Canadian patients and adjudicate more than 100 million pharmacy, dental, and extended health claims annually. Through our proprietary consumer intelligence, clinical expertise, and patients-first approach, we promote better health decisions for plan members, while managing and reducing drug benefit costs for plan sponsors.
